HTTP和HTTPS的不同?HTTPS如何加密的?

HTTP (Hypertext Transfer Protocol) 是一种用于传输数据的协议,常用于Web应用程序和浏览器之间的通信。

HTTPS (HTTP Secure) 是一种更加安全的HTTP协议。它通过使用SSL/TLS协议来加密HTTP传输的数据。SSL/TLS协议使用了一些非对称加密和对称加密算法来保护用户数据的安全。其中,非对称加密算法用于加密公开密钥,保证数据传输的安全,对称加密算法用于加密数据,保证数据传输的速度。

HTTPS的优点:

防止信息被窃取:通过加密数据,即使被黑客拦截,也无法读取数据。

防止数据篡改:HTTPS可以确认数据的完整性,若数据在传输过程中被篡改,会被服务器拒绝。

防止伪装:HTTPS使用SSL证书,可以确保客户端连接的是服务器本身,而非伪造的服务器。

总之,HTTPS相比HTTP更加安全可靠,更适合进行敏感数据传输。

你可能感兴趣的:(HTTP和HTTPS的不同?HTTPS如何加密的?)